Transaction 2a9770d65fd591d047e80ae0c7280f63e893ce919b3df06f0820aa5dbf166826

30 Input
1 Outputs
  • 2a9770d65fd591d047e80ae0c7280f63e893ce919b3df06f0820aa5dbf166826:0
  • value  601860488
    address  1N7jWPrYMbHevFhXNdVon2gT221VcDiY7C